A lehenga is a traditional Indian outfit popularly worn by women at weddings and parties. It is an essential part of the wardrobe for these special occasions and can be a great way to make a statement. But with so many styles and designs to choose from, it can be difficult to find the perfect lehenga for your special occasion.

This guide will provide you with all the information you need to make the perfect choice for your wedding or party.

Types of Lehengas

There are different types of lehengas to choose from, depending on your style and the occasion you're attending.

  • Traditional lehengas are full and flared, while sharara lehengas are wide-legged pants paired with a long blouse and dupatta.
  • A-line lehengas have a flared skirt resembling an "A," while mermaid lehengas hug the body and flare out at the bottom.
  • Straight-cut lehengas have a fitted top and a straight, narrow skirt, while Indo-western lehengas combine traditional and modern styles.
  • Cocktail lehengas are chunky, bright, and have designer sleeves in blouses, while jacket lehengas feature a long jacket over the blouse.
  • You can also mix and match different lehenga pieces to create a unique outfit.

Fabrics

The fabric of your lehenga plays a crucial role in its overall look and feel. Silk, georgette, chiffon, velvet, net, crepe, satin, and brocade are some of the most popular fabrics used in lehengas. Each fabric has unique properties, such as its drape, texture, and weight, which can impact the overall look of your lehenga.

Colors and Prints

Choosing the right color and print for your lehenga is equally important. Traditional colors like red, gold, and green are still popular, but modern colors like pastels, metallics, and bold hues are also gaining popularity. You should also consider prints and designs that suit your style and the occasion you wear the lehenga.

Additionally, it's important to choose a color that compliments your skin tone.

Embellishments

Embellishments like threadwork, zari and zardozi work, sequins, mirrorwork, beadwork, and stonework can add a touch of glamour to your lehenga. When choosing the embellishments for your lehenga, it's important to consider the occasion and style.

Choosing the Right Lehenga for the Occasion

Different occasions call for different types of lehengas. For weddings, a traditional lehenga with heavy embellishments is usually preferred, while a cocktail party may call for a lighter lehenga with modern designs. Corporate events and formal dinners may require a more subdued and sophisticated look.

Body Type

Different lehengas suit different body types. It's essential to consider your body shape when choosing a lehenga. For instance, if you have an hourglass figure, a mermaid lehenga or a jacket lehenga would be an ideal choice. If you have a pear-shaped body, a flared lehenga or a sharara lehenga would be more flattering.

Timeless Design

It's important to consider a timeless design while choosing a trendy or fashionable lehenga that you'll be happy with in years to come. A classic lehenga that flatters your body type and suits your style will always be a good investment.

Consider choosing a lehenga with traditional embroideries, such as zardozi, or opt for a solid color lehenga with minimal embellishments that can be dressed up or down for different occasions.
